PLACES TO VISIT
Some places to visit around Spain are the Museo
Sorolla (A museum full of a person’s paintings and
relics that used to be his home. It also has a
FABULOUS garden with fountains, tiles, and small
statues), The Alcazar of Segovia (the Spanish royal
palace), and Segovia, (a city with a completely
stable ancient Roman aqueduct, and an amazing
resteraunt selling cochinillo). A place there that is
completely remote but completely amazing is a tiny
village called Navas Del Pinar that has a yearly
baking competition different people judge each
year, where the road getting resurfaced is a big
deal, they have a special summer festival, and they
have an actual TOWN WATER FOUNTAIN
THINGY. Navas is also very near to a mountain
called Pico De Navas. One other place you can visit
(in Madrid, not Navas)is the "Marvelous Market", a
market selling literally EVERYTHING.
